Zesty Mediterranean Egg & Feta Bake

A flavorful and zesty Mediterranean-inspired egg and feta bake, perfect for breakfast, brunch, or a light meal. It features spinach, sun-dried tomatoes, Kalamata olives, and crumbled feta cheese with eggs and milk.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 40 minutes
Total Time 55 minutes
Servings 6 servings
Calories 280 kcal

Equipment

  • 9x13 inch baking dish
  • skillet
  • large bowl
  • whisk

Ingredients
  

Main Ingredients

  • 1 cup chopped spinach fresh or frozen, thawed and squeezed dry
  • 1/2 cup chopped sun-dried tomatoes oil-packed, drained
  • 1/4 cup Kalamata olives halved
  • 4 ounces crumbled feta cheese
  • 8 large eggs
  • 1/2 cup whole milk
  • 1/2 teaspoon dried oregano
  • 1/4 teaspoon garlic powder
  • Salt and black pepper to taste
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il for sautéing
  • 3-4 whole-wheat bread slices, cubed (for a heartier bake, omit for crustless)

Instructions
 

Preparation

  • Grease a 9x13 inch baking dish with butter or cooking spray.
  • Heat olive oil in a skillet and sauté fresh spinach and sun-dried tomatoes for 2-3 minutes; if using frozen spinach, simply warm it with the tomatoes.
  • If desired, spread cubed bread evenly in the bottom of the prepared baking dish.
  • Distribute the sautéed vegetable mixture, Kalamata olives, and crumbled feta cheese over the bread or directly into the dish.
  • In a large bowl, whisk together eggs, milk, dried oregano, garlic powder, salt, and pepper until smooth.
  • Pour the egg mixture over the vegetables and feta in the baking dish, then cover and refrigerate for at least 4 hours or overnight.

Baking

  •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
  • Bake for 35-45 minutes, until the edges are set and the center has a slight wobble; for a browned top, broil for the last 1-2 minutes, watching carefully.
  • Let the bake stand for a few minutes before slicing and serving.

Notes

This bake is perfect for meal prepping and can be enjoyed hot or cold. For an extra kick, add a pinch of red pepper flakes to the egg mixture. You can also customize the vegetables with bell peppers or zucchini.
